Cheryl A. Carreiro

November 27, 1960 — February 10, 2025

Lincoln

Cheryl passed away peacefully on Monday, February 10, 2025. Born in Central Falls she was the beloved daughter of Pauline Carreiro and the late Ronald Carreiro. She was the sister of Norman (Kathy), Steven (Karen), Joseph (Holly). She was predeceased by her sister Rhonda, Uncle Norman Carreiro, Aunt Charlotte Galligan, Uncle Raymond Paulhus and Uncle Gerard Paulhus.  She is survived by her Aunts, Dolores Parker, Dorothy Hatcher (Edward), Uncles Edward Paulhus (Dora) and Roger Paulhus, as well as several cousins.  She also leaves her nieces Jamie, Ashley, Charissa, nephews Norman, Brandon and several great nieces and nephews. Cheryl will be deeply missed by her “Second Family” Marianne, MaryAnn, Jasmene, Celeste, and all her devoted support staff at Cobble Hill. Cheryl was raised in the Catholic Faith, grew up and received her Sacraments in Saint Edwards Church, Pawtucket.


Cheryl’s beautiful smile, adventurous spirit, kind heart, sense of humor and gentle nature endeared her to everyone she knew. She was very social and had many friends. She enjoyed traveling, including several cruises and Las Vegas, iced coffee, movies, music, coloring, birthdays, dancing, WWE Wrestling and having her nails done.


Visiting hours will be held, Thursday, February 13th from 4-7 pm in the Robbins Funeral Home, 2251 Mineral Spring Avenue, North Providence. Her funeral will be held on Friday, February 14th at 8:45 am from the funeral home, followed by a Mass of Christian Burial at 10 am in Saint John the Baptist Church, Pawtucket. Burial will be private.


Donations in Cheryl’s memory can be made to: The Fogarty Center 310 Maple Ave Suite 102 Barrington, RI 02806
